Tennant Company Reports Third Quarter 2023 Results

Delivers Strong Net Sales and Net Income Growth

Increases Full-Year 2023 Guidance

MINNEAPOLIS, MN (Oct. 31, 2023)—Tennant Company ("Tennant" or the "Company") (NYSE: TNC) today reported its financial results for the quarter ended September 30, 2023.

(In millions, except per share data) Three Months Ended September 30,
2023 2022 Increase
Net sales $ 304.7  $ 262.9  15.9  %
Net income $ 22.9  $ 15.6  46.8  %
Diluted EPS $ 1.21  $ 0.83  45.8  %
Adjusted diluted EPS $ 1.34  $ 0.98  36.7  %
Adjusted EBITDA $ 45.9  $ 33.8  35.8  %
Adjusted EBITDA margin % 15.1  % 12.9  % 220 bps

Highlights
•Delivered net sales of $304.7 million for the third quarter of 2023, an increase of 15.9% from the third quarter of 2022, or 13.9% on an organic basis due to strong pricing realization and volume growth. A more stable supply-chain environment drove a sequential increase in production which resulted in a $41 million decrease in the Company's backlog to $214 million.

•Achieved Adjusted EBITDA of $45.9 million in the third quarter of 2023, compared to $33.8 million in the prior-year period, an increase of $12.1 million. Adjusted EBITDA margin of 15.1% improved by 220 basis points primarily due to strong sales growth and gross margin improvements.

•Generated operating cash flow of $54.4 million and converted over 100% of net income to free cash flow for the third consecutive quarter. Announced a 5.7% increase in the Company's quarterly cash dividend to $0.28 per share, marking the 52nd consecutive year the Company has increased its annual cash dividend payout.

•Increased its full-year 2023 guidance and now expects net sales between $1.23 billion and $1.25 billion and Adjusted EBITDA between $190 million and $200 million.

Net Sales
Consolidated net sales for the third quarter of 2023 totaled $304.7 million, a 15.9% increase compared to consolidated net sales of $262.9 million in the third quarter of 2022. The components of the consolidated net sales change were as follows:
Three Months Ended September 30,
2023 vs. 2022
Price 8.9%
Volume 5.0%
Organic growth 13.9%
Foreign currency 2.0%
Total growth 15.9%

Organic Sales
Organic sales, which excludes the effects of foreign currency, increased 13.9% compared to the prior year, due to growth across all regions led by strong equipment sales, particularly in the Americas region.

Three Months Ended September 30, 2023
Americas EMEA APAC Total
Organic net sales growth 20.8% (2.8)% 11.8% 13.9%

Americas: The 20.8% increase in the Americas, which includes all of North America and Latin America, was driven equally by price realization and volume increases in equipment and service product categories.

EMEA: The 2.8% decrease in EMEA, which includes Europe, the Middle East and Africa, was due to volume declines in both equipment and parts and consumables partly offset by price realization in all product categories. EMEA volumes were impacted by weaker-than-expected market conditions.

APAC: The 11.8% increase in APAC, which includes China, Australia, Japan and other Asian markets, was primarily driven by price realization in Australia and volume growth in China.

Operating Results
Gross profit margin of 43.3% was 500 basis points higher in the third quarter of 2023 compared to the third quarter of 2022. The increase was the result of price realization, which more than offset the multi-year impact of inflation.

Adjusted EBITDA was $45.9 million in the third quarter of 2023, compared to $33.8 million in the prior-year period. The improvement in Adjusted EBITDA was primarily due to strong sales growth, driven by both volume and price, and gross margin expansion. Adjusted EBITDA margin for the third quarter 2023 was 15.1%, a 220 basis point increase over the prior-year period benefiting from operating leverage created by sales growth.

Net income was $22.9 million in the third quarter of 2023 compared to $15.6 million in the third quarter of 2022. Strong operating performance, driven by higher pricing realization and volume increases, was partly offset by higher variable costs, interest costs and income taxes.

Cash Flow, Liquidity and Capital Allocation
Tennant generated $54.4 million in cash flow from operations during the third quarter of 2023, a $69.6 million increase compared to the prior-year period. The increase was driven by strong operating performance and moderating investments in working capital. The Company converted over 100% of net income to free cash flow for the third consecutive quarter.

Liquidity remained strong with a balance of $97.0 million in cash and cash equivalents as of the end of the third quarter, with approximately $316.9 million of unused borrowing capacity on the Company’s revolving credit facility.

The Company continues to deploy cash flow toward operational capital needs and to return capital to shareholders in line with its capital allocation priorities, while managing debt and keeping its net leverage well within the targeted range. During the third quarter, the Company invested $3.5 million in capital expenditures, reduced outstanding debt by $56.2 million, and returned $6.7 million to shareholders through dividends and share repurchases.

As previously announced, Tennant’s Board of Directors authorized a 5.7% increase in the Company's quarterly cash dividend to $0.28 per share. The increased dividend is payable on December 15, 2023, to shareholders of record at the close of business on November 30, 2023.

Company Profile
Founded in 1870, Tennant Company (TNC), headquartered in Eden Prairie, Minnesota, is a world leader in the design, manufacture and marketing of solutions that help create a cleaner, safer and healthier world. Its products include equipment for maintaining surfaces in industrial, commercial and outdoor environments; detergent-free and other sustainable cleaning technologies; and cleaning tools and supplies. Tennant's global field service network is the most extensive in the industry. Tennant Company had sales of $1.09 billion in 2022 and has approximately 4,300 employees. Tennant has manufacturing operations throughout the world and sells products directly in 15 countries and through distributors in more than 100 countries. Non-GAAP Financial Measures
This news release and the related conference call include presentation of Non-GAAP measures that include or exclude special items of a nonrecurring and/or nonoperational nature (hereinafter referred to as “special items”). Management believes that the Non-GAAP measures provide useful information to investors regarding the Company’s results of operations and financial condition because they permit a more meaningful comparison and understanding of Tennant Company’s operating performance for the current, past or future periods. Management uses these Non-GAAP measures to monitor and evaluate ongoing operating results and trends and to gain an understanding of the comparative operating performance of the Company.

The Company believes that disclosing selling and administrative (“S&A”) expense – as adjusted, S&A expense as a percent of net sales – as adjusted, operating income – as adjusted, operating margin – as adjusted, income before income taxes – as adjusted, income tax expense – as adjusted, net income – as adjusted, net income per diluted share – as adjusted, EBITDA – as adjusted, and EBITDA margin – as adjusted (collectively, the “Non-GAAP measures”), excluding the impacts from special items, is useful to investors as a measure of operating performance. The Company uses these as one measure to monitor and evaluate operating performance. The Non-GAAP measures are financial measures that do not reflect United States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P). The Company calculates the Non-GAAP measures by adjusting for restructuring-related charges and amortization expense, and any gain or loss on a sale of assets. The Company calculates income tax expense – as adjusted by adjusting for the tax effect of these Non-GAAP measures. The Company calculates net income per diluted share – as adjusted by adjusting for the after-tax effect of these Non-GAAP measures and dividing the result by the diluted weighted average shares outstanding. The Company calculates operating margin – as adjusted by dividing operating income – as adjusted by net sales. The Company calculates EBITDA margin – as adjusted by dividing EBITDA – as adjusted by net sales.
